SUMMARY:Hirdie Girdie Gallery’s January Featured Artist David King
DESCRIPTION:Hirdie Girdie Gallery's Featured Artist for January is David King.\n\nHe a self-taught watercolor artist\, specializing in nature's many moods. He started painting in 1967 while serving in the Air Force\, stationed in Wyoming. He experimented with many different media\, settling on transparent watercolors because of the challenge. After practicing dentistry in Michigan for 31 years\, he retired to Southwest Florida\, returning to Michigan in the summer to enjoy fishing\, hunting\, and traveling throughout the United States\, Canada\, and Alaska for inspiration\, concentrating on birds and animals in their habitat.  \n\nHe is an award winning artist\, having been invited to the Winners Circle Show of the Art Council of Southwest Florida\, poster artist for Art on the Rocks in Marquette\, Michigan\, and the Cape Coral Art Show. His most memorable experience was being accepted as Artist-in-Residence in Denali National Park\, Alaska\, where one of his paintings in on display at Eielson Visitors Center. \n\nMeet David at our January Reception\, and enjoy live music by Bob Housler\, wine and hors d'oeuvres with old and new friends!
